Torsiglieri joins Sporting CP

Sporting Clube de Portugal have strengthened their squad by signing young defender Marco Torsiglieri from Velez Sarsfield. The transfer fee for the 22 year old was not officially disclosed, but reports in Argentina have it to be somewhere around $4.5m.

Torsiglieri becomes the third new addition to Sporting’s ranks this summer, joining Evaldo and Maniche at Estadio Jose Alvalade.

The Castelar born defender started his career with Velez and spent the 2007/08 season on loan at Talleres de Córdoba. He made around 30 appearances for both outfits in his stay in Argentina.

Torsiglieri can play both in the centre and in the left side on defence. He becomes the second Argentine player on Sporting’s current roster along with Leandro Grimi.
